Abstract
The invention essentially relates to a window regulator mechanism (1) which allows the window (C) to be opened and closed with less components by means of the guide (3) which moves together with the window (C) and is made on the surface of the door inner frame plate (2), and the regulator assembly (4) which is put on the guide (3).

A WINDOW REGULATOR MECHANISM
Field of the Invention
The present invention relates to a window regulator mechanism which enables the up and down movement of the window in motor vehicles and moves together with the window. Background of the Invention
Today electronic components are widely used in automotive sector as they are used in every other sectors. The processes performed mechanically have become easier by adding simple electronic mechanisms to the present systems. The electric window systems operate based on moving the door or roof windows to be moved with the help of an electric motor by pushing a button. In electric window systems, auxiliary equipments are added to the mechanical window systems. The window opening handle is cancelled and window lifting motor is added instead. The said motor operating with electricity is controlled via an electric switch located inside the cabin, and the windows are closed and opened. German Patent Document no DEI 02008054895, an application known in the state, of the art, discloses a window lifter arrangement. In the door module, there is a window lifter arrangement with two deflecting elements, a guide element and an actuator for a window pane. The guide element is designed for guiding a movement of the actuator. The actuator is connected to the window lifter drive with a cable. In the invention, there is a guide rail fixed on the door on the lifter system and the rail is connected to the door with brackets. In the said system, the lifter is fixed on the door. The guide rails are mounted on the door via the brackets. Besides the unit powering the lifter mechanism is fixed on the door. The movement is transferred to the window via the cable and the rollers.
Korean Patent Document no KR20010063466(A), an application known in the state of the art, discloses a window regulating device which holds the window glass and does not move it upwards and downwards. The window regulator is located on a door panel module. There is a driving motor and a driving gear on the module. In the door inner panel, there are support channels mounted at both sides of the module door panel; a guide rail having rollers, and sticking a window glass; a main arm fixed in a shaft of the driving gear; and an auxiliary arm fixed in the guide rail and a guide arm. Korean Patent Document no KR20000012743 (A), an application known in the state of the art, discloses a window regulating device which minimizes the weight and decreases the noise and sound. The mechanism comprises a mounting plate fixed in an inner part of a door; a positive and opposite driving motor installed in the mounting plate; a drum rotating in a positive or negative direction according to the direction of the drive; a guide rail installed to stand in the rising direction of a window glass; a carrier plate. In the said document, the regulator system is fixed on the door and the power unit transfers the movement to the glass with a switch mechanism. In the documents mentioned above, a regulator mechanism that can move with the window is not disclosed.
Summary of the Invention The objective of the present invention is to provide a window regulator which can move with the window.
Another objective of the present invention is to provide a window regulator mechanism which has a gear system applied on door inner frame plate instead of guide piece.
A further objective of the present invention is to provide a window regulator mechanism the first investment costs and the process times of which are lower than the state of the art. Yet another objective of the present invention is to provide a window regulator mechanism which allows performing same process with less components by means of being able to move with the window.

The inventive window regulator mechanism (1) comprises:
- at least one frame plate (2) which is the inner part of the vehicle door,
- at least one guide (3) which is made on the surface of the frame plate (2), -at least one regulator assembly (4) which moves on the guide (3);
at least one regulator body (5) which is an element of the regulator assembly (4) and moves by being put on the guide (3),
- at least one protrusion (6) which is provided outwards the regulator body
(5),
at least two gear wheels (7) which are mounted on both sides of the regulator body (5),
at least one regulator motor (8) which is located inside the regulator body (5),
- at least two lower wheels (9) which are mounted on both sides of the regulator motor (8) and provide movement by contacting the gear wheel (7),
hole (10) which is made on the frame plate (2) and enables the regulator assembly (4) to move together with the window (C) upon the gear wheel
(7) and the lower wheels (9) contacting each other move therein,
- at least one electric cable (11) which transmits electric to the regulator motor (8) in the regulator assembly (4),
- at least one socket (12) which is provided at the other end of the electric cable (11) and attached to the electric installation coming to the door from the vehicle body.
In the inventive window regulator mechanism (1), the window (C) is attached to the door and lifted to the upper position manually. In this position, the window (C) is completely closed on the door. The regulator assembly (4) is placed on the guide (3) made on the surface of the frame plate (2) and the gear wheels (7) and the lower wheels (9) are placed into the holes (10) made on the frame plate (2). The window (C) is pushed downwards from the closed position on the door and placed into the protrusion (6) on the regulator body (5). By this means mechanical connection is provided between the window (C) and the regulator assembly (4). The regulator assembly (4) performs its upwards or downwards movement with the window (C). The electric cable (1 1) is fixed on the door frame plate (2) with any connection member (screw, clips, etc). The socket (12) of the electric cable (1 1) is attached to the socket of the electric installation coming to the door from the vehicle body, and thus the electric connection is provided.
In the preferred embodiment of the invention, the regulator assembly (4) is comprised of the regulator body (5) and the protrusion (6) on its surface, gear wheel (7), regulator motor (8) and the lower wheels (9) connected to the regulator motor (8).
When the user wants to open or close the window (C), the electric coming to the door from the vehicle body upon pushing the button on the door handle is transmitted to the regulator motor (8) with the electric cable (11). The regulator motor (8) transfers the rotational movement to the lower wheels (9) provided on both sides on its shaft and thus to the gear wheels (7). The teeth of the gear wheels (7) inserted into the holes (10) on the frame plate (2) push the frame plate (2) with the rotational movement since they are inserted into the holes (10) on the door frame plate (2) and starts to move the regulator assembly (4). The regulator assembly (4) moving inside the guide (3) made on the frame plate (2) moves the window (C) attached to the protrusion (6) thereon together with itself.
In the preferred embodiment of the invention, the electric cable (1 1) is folded or opened according to the movement of the regulator assembly (4). In the alternative embodiment of the invention, the electric cable (11) is shape of an accordion and it can elongate or shorten according to the movement of the regulator assembly (4).
The inventive window regulator mechanism (1) is a mechanism which moves the window (C) by carrying directly on itself without requiring any additional mechanism. For this reason, being different from the previous art, it enables to reduce the first investment cost since additional connection members are not required and furthermore it also enables to decrease maintenance and repair costs since it does not comprise extra components.
